LS1 No start conditon

I purchased two of LS1 coil harness from Ebay some time ago. My motor was missing them when I purchased it.

This week I attempted to start the 1998 LS1 motor, for the first time, and immediately blew a 15A ignition fuse.
It turns out the harness were pined backwards (like they were assembled by looking at the wrong end of the plug) All coils were grounded at ign pin so they were all pulling 6 amps each and of course wouldn't fire any plugs this way.

I have sworn off of any electrical products purchases from eBay. With the column switches the lone exception. Too many junky products without any quality controls.

Good news is the system no longer blows fuses and I have spark and fuel.
Bad news is this evidently isn't the only issue and I still haven't been able to get the motor started.

This is a bugger as the tech that builds harness was unable to find the issue. Computer is powering up. Codes can be read. Coils are hot. Fuel pump comes on for three seconds and stop when the key is on. Fuel pressure is perfect. We have tried more than one computer, re-flashed the computer, confirmed the grounds, the system will flash a noid light, changed out the cam sensor. Has spark. Reading the motor temperature correctly.

Motor has a new stage 1 BTR truck cam other than the cam it's stock.

I am going to confirm the compression as an academic exercise tomorrow.
After that I am unsure what to do. ECM Harness Tech guy is working with me and answers all my questions and is very knowledgeable.
